FTGRX vs. FXAIX
Compare and contrast key facts about Fidelity Advisor Mega Cap Stock Fund Class M (FTGRX) and Fidelity 500 Index Fund (FXAIX).
FTGRX is managed by Fidelity. It was launched on Feb 5, 2008. FXAIX is a passively managed fund by Fidelity that tracks the performance of the S&P 500 Index. It was launched on Feb 17, 1988.

FTGRX vs. FXAIX - Expense Ratio Comparison
FTGRX has a 1.15% expense ratio, which is higher than FXAIX's 0.02% expense ratio.

Correlation
The correlation between FTGRX and FXAIX is 0.95,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.
